What, exactly, is coffee doing inside the gut, where trillions of microbes help break down food and shape the chemicals that end up in our blood?<\/p>\n\n\n\n<p>A new open-access paper points to a surprisingly specific answer. Across tens of thousands of stool samples, coffee drinkers were more likely to carry higher levels of one bacterium, <a href=\"https:\/\/www.microbiologyresearch.org\/content\/journal\/ijsem\/10.1099\/ijsem.0.002800\" target=\"_blank\" rel=\"noopener\">Lawsonibacter asaccharolyticus<\/a>, and lab tests suggested coffee can help it grow.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">A coffee-linked microbe shows up again and again<\/h2>\n\n\n\n<p>The researchers analyzed detailed diet data from 22,867 people in the United States and the United Kingdom, then compared those results with public microbiome datasets totaling 54,198 samples. <\/p>\n\n\n\n<p>The coffee signal kept reappearing across different cohorts, which matters because diet studies often fail to replicate outside a single group.<\/p>\n\n\n\n<div class=\"gb-element-a00da4e5\">\n<div><div class=\"gb-looper-46613eed\">\n<div class=\"gb-loop-item gb-loop-item-a8390598 post-32034 post type-post status-publish format-standard has-post-thumbnail hentry category-science resize-featured-image\">\n<h3 class=\"gb-text gb-text-24a51617\">Read More: <a href=\"https:\/\/www.ecoticias.com\/en\/a-bathtub-ring-on-mars-may-be-the-strongest-clue-yet-that-an-ancient-ocean-once-covered-a-third-of-the-red-planet\/32034\/\">A \u2018bathtub ring\u2019 on Mars may be the strongest clue yet that an ancient ocean once covered a third of the Red Planet<\/a><\/h3>\n<\/div>\n<\/div><\/div>\n<\/div>\n\n\n\n<p>The standout was Lawsonibacter asaccharolyticus, a gut microbe first isolated in 2018. In several cohorts, its typical abundance was about 4.5 to 8 times higher in heavy coffee drinkers than in non-drinkers, and it was also more common in moderate drinkers.<\/p>\n\n\n\n<p>The pattern did not seem to be only about caffeine. When the team looked at decaf intake in subsets where it was tracked, the same bacterium still tracked with coffee, suggesting other <a href=\"https:\/\/www.ecoticias.com\/en\/effect-of-drinking-chocolate-in-winter\/23195\/\">coffee compounds<\/a> may be involved.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">What the team did in plain English<\/h2>\n\n\n\n<p>Think of the gut microbiome as a busy neighborhood of microscopic residents. The team used DNA sequencing of stool samples to estimate which microbes were present and roughly how abundant they were, then matched that to long-term coffee habits reported in <a href=\"https:\/\/www.ecoticias.com\/en\/food-packs-nutrient-bomb-antioxidants\/21617\/\">food questionnaires<\/a>.<\/p>\n\n\n\n<p>They also ran controlled lab experiments using a stored reference strain of Lawsonibacter asaccharolyticus. In simple terms, they grew the bacterium with coffee added to its food, and it tended to grow better at some coffee concentrations, including with decaf preparations.<\/p>\n\n\n\n<div class=\"gb-element-40418f90\">\n<div><div class=\"gb-looper-1d2c9596\">\n<div class=\"gb-loop-item gb-loop-item-98e91ef6 post-32008 post type-post status-publish format-standard has-post-thumbnail hentry category-environment resize-featured-image\">\n<h3 class=\"gb-text gb-text-23185280\">Read More: <a href=\"https:\/\/www.ecoticias.com\/en\/what-looked-like-a-wall-full-of-grooves-in-the-adriatic-sea-turned-out-to-be-the-trail-of-hundreds-of-terrified-turtles-79-million-years-ago\/32008\/\">What looked like a wall full of grooves in the Adriatic Sea turned out to be the trail of hundreds of terrified turtles 79 million years ago<\/a><\/h3>\n<\/div>\n<\/div><\/div>\n<\/div>\n\n\n\n<p>To connect this to chemistry, the researchers looked at blood samples from a smaller subset and searched for <a href=\"https:\/\/www.cancer.gov\/publications\/dictionaries\/cancer-terms\/def\/metabolite\" target=\"_blank\" rel=\"noopener\">metabolites<\/a>, which are the small molecules made when the body and microbes process food. Coffee drinkers showed higher levels of well-known coffee-related compounds, and quinic acid stood out as especially tied to both coffee intake and this bacterium.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Why it matters and what it does not prove<\/h2>\n\n\n\n<p>If you have ever wondered why coffee\u2019s health links can look so consistent across studies, the gut may be part of the story. Coffee has been associated in other large human research with outcomes like lower mortality risk, although those studies cannot prove cause and effect on their own.<\/p>\n\n\n\n<p>This new work adds a more \u201cmechanistic\u201d clue by pairing population data with lab growth tests. It also fits with earlier experiments showing that coffee compounds can be transformed by gut microbes in ways that may shift which microbes thrive. Still, this is not a reason to treat coffee like medicine.\u00a0<\/p>\n\n\n\n<div class=\"gb-element-281c32d3\">\n<div><div class=\"gb-looper-5c806828\">\n<div class=\"gb-loop-item gb-loop-item-03be9cff post-32004 post type-post status-publish format-standard has-post-thumbnail hentry category-science resize-featured-image\">\n<h3 class=\"gb-text gb-text-da8fa59f\">Read More: <a href=\"https:\/\/www.ecoticias.com\/en\/a-4000-year-old-object-stored-in-denmark-may-preserve-one-of-humanitys-earliest-written-traces-of-everyday-administration-and-its-silence-lasted-millennia\/32004\/\">A 4,000-year-old object stored in Denmark may preserve one of humanity\u2019s earliest written traces of everyday administration, and its silence lasted millennia<\/a><\/h3>\n<\/div>\n<\/div><\/div>\n<\/div>\n\n\n\n<p>The study links coffee to a microbe and to blood chemicals, but it does not show that increasing Lawsonibacter asaccharolyticus will improve health, or that starting coffee will help someone who avoids it.
